I suggest implementing 2 aircraft modifications for Hanriot  HD1:

 

1. smaller windscreen with barely visible metal frame,

2. MG placed to the side of front part of fuselage.

 

This aircraft modifications are historically accurate. Various historical photos show that mentioned mods were quite common in Belgian and Italian service.
